About Gigacloud Technology Inc

Gigacloud Technology operates a global B2B e-commerce marketplace for large-parcel goods. It provides a comprehensive solution for furniture manufacturers and retailers with integrated logistics and fulfillment.

About iShares iBoxx $ High Yield Corporate Bond ETF

HYG is the world's largest high-yield bond ETF, tracking the Markit iBoxx USD Liquid High Yield Index. It provides liquid exposure to non-investment grade corporate debt, with 2026 top holdings including Cloud Software Group and Medline.
